Whitney Houston To Begin Comeback In London

February 29th, 2008 8:00am EST  Post a comment    Read 4 comments   Add to My News

Whitney HoustonWhitney Houston is set to make her live comeback in London on May 8. Organizers of the Caudwell Children's Legend Ball in Battersea have revealed they've booked the diva for a charity show.

Charity founder John Caudwell tells Britain's Marie Claire magazine, "We are thrilled to have an artist of Whitney's caliber to headline the event."

The comeback concert isn't a big surprise - Tina Turner came out of retirement to perform at the charity's 2007 gala, which helped Caudwell raise over $2 million for disabled children.

Houston is currently recording a new album with her mentor, music mogul Clive Davis, who claims the comeback project will be released in November.
